Seat Walkers
Let’s start with walkers. When choosing a walker, what should you look for? If you need the flexibility to sit down during your outings, you might consider a hybrid model like the Ansa Trekker. It flips around to function as a wheelchair as well. However, it’s important to note that while hybrid models are convenient, they may not offer the best of both worlds. For someone looking for a durable and lightweight solution, the Viva Walker might be a better and more user-friendly option.
The Viva Walker features larger wheels, making it perfect for daily outings like a trip to the shops or a walk around the park. It also has a storage bag to keep your items within reach and a lightweight frame that folds easily for compact storage. Plus, we can’t help but mention the stylish rose gold and meteor grey colours that give this walker a touch of flair.
Wheelchairs
Now, let’s talk about wheelchairs. Choosing the right wheelchair involves a lot of factors. Do you prefer a wheelchair that you can propel on your own or one that requires someone else to help push you around? Will you be using it indoors or outdoors, and how frequently will you need it? We also touched on essential bathroom products that can enhance your stability. A simple toilet frame or raised toilet seat can make all the difference when it comes to supporting your posture and keeping you steady on your feet. If you have difficulty raising or lowering yourself from a standard toilet seat, these are great options to help you keep your independence in the bathroom.
